HARRIS Clarence Harris "Chicken", age 61, passed away Saturday, February 3, 2001 at Grant Medical Center. Former resident of "FlyTown". Employed by Ohio Malleable Company. Preceded in death by parents Clarence and Maggie Wallace Harris. Survived by daughter, Diane (Butch) Fugua; sisters, Maggie Lash, Henrietta Williams, Barbara (John D.) Franklin; 2 grandchildren; 1 great-grandchild; many nieces, nephews, cousins, other relatives and friends, including good friends, Johnny Goins, Hoagie, Bennie Harris, Freddie Gray. Celebration of Life Service 1 p.m. Monday, February 12, 2001 at Rehoboth Temple Church, 1111 E. Long St. Bishop Nathaniel Jordan officiating. Interment Glen Rest Estates. Family will receive friends from 12noon until the time of service. Arrangements by J.W. ROSS FUNERAL HOME, 1173 E. Hudson St.

KESKE Ronald William Keske, age 68, went to be with Our Lord on February 7, 2001 at Mt. Carmel East Hospital. He was born in Cleveland, Oh., the son of Edmund and Mildred Keske. Graduate Mayfield High School, class of 1950; graduate Case Western University from the School of Architecture. He received the Alpha Rho Chi Leadership Service Merit Medal upon his graduation in 1955. He served in the U.S.A.F. as a pilot in the Strategic Air Command (SAC), and retired with the rank of Captain. He became a partner with Wright, Gilfillen, Keske Architects, vice president of Property Management for the Huntington Banks, vice president with Ohio Equities Construction, and a teacher with Evangel Christian Academy, past president of the Reynoldsburg Jaycee's and honorary International Senator, member and officer Case Western University Alumni Association, Columbus Chapter, longtime member of the Boy Scouts of America and recipient of the Silver Beaver Award, member Germania Singing and Sports Society, worked with the homeless ministries in the Columbus area along with his wife Shirley; member Evangel Temple Assembly of God. Survived by wife, Shirley; daughter, Pamela of Seattle, Wash.; sons, Brian W. of Cleveland, Bruce E. (Rebecca) of Lima, Bradford E. of Columbus; grandchildren, Matthew 16, Jonathon 12, Rachel 6, of Lima and Ariadna 3 of Seattle, Wash.; host of friends. Friends may call Sunday 2-4 and 6-8 p.m., EVANS FUNERAL HOME, 4171 E. Livingston Ave. Celebrating the life of Ron Keske and Memorial Service Monday 1 p.m., Evangel Temple Assembly of God, 817 N. Hamilton Rd., Gahanna. Pastor Eugene Speich officiating. In lieu of flowers, contributions would gratefully be received by Evangel Christian Academy or Teen Challenge of Columbus, c/o Evangel Temple.

MARTIN Gail A. Martin, age 76, of Columbus, died Wednesday, February 7, 2001 at Riverside Methodist Hospital. Retired from the U.S. Postal Service. Preceded in death by wife Florence Martin. Survived by sons, Ronald and Terrance Lee (Emma) Martin; sisters, Donna (Bob) Crabtree, Dorothy Richardson and Tessabelle Fraizer; grandchildren, Rodney and Angie; 5 great-grandchildren; many nieces and nephews. Member of Indianola Church of Christ, Neoacacia Lodge #595 F.&A.M., Scioto Consistory, Valley of Columbus AASR, Aladdin Temple Shrine and the Registrar Unit, Loyal Order of Moose Lodge #1427, Capital City Lodge #5 F.O.P., American Legion Post #239, AMVETS Post #89. Veteran of WW II, U.S. Coast Guard Reserve. An umpire and referee for NCAA Baseball and Basketball and a Redcoat at OSU for 27 years. Masonic Service 8 p.m. Saturday, February 10, 2001 at RUTHERFORD FUNERAL HOME, 2383 North High St., Columbus, where friends may call from 7-9 p.m. prior to and following the service. Interment Sunset Cemetery. His last words were, "I am going to heaven to see my God, my wife and Woody Hayes. Go Bucks."
